Meta Acquires Play AI to Boost Conversational AI Capabilities

Meta AI Acquires Play AI

Meta has officially acquired Play AI, a California-based startup renowned for its cutting-edge artificial intelligence technology that generates human-like voices. The move, confirmed by a Meta spokesperson, underscores the tech giant’s commitment to advancing conversational AI and enhancing audio experiences across its platforms.

Play AI Team Joins Meta’s AI Division

The entire Play AI team will transition to Meta within the coming week. The memo highlighted that Play AI’s expertise in creating natural-sounding voices and its user-friendly voice creation platform align perfectly with Meta’s roadmap, spanning AI Characters, Meta AI, wearable devices, and audio content creation.

Why Play AI? A Strategic Fit for Meta’s Vision

Meta’s acquisition of Play AI is more than just a technology grab—it’s a strategic step to bolster its suite of AI-driven products:

  • Voice Cloning & Natural Speech: Play AI’s tools enable the generation and replication of lifelike voices for use in apps, websites, and devices.
  • Integration Potential: The technology is expected to enhance products such as Meta AI, AI Characters, and smart wearables, making interactions more fluid and realistic.
  • Leadership: The Play AI team will report directly to Johan Schalkwyk, a prominent figure in speech AI who recently joined Meta from Sesame AI.

Meta’s Broader AI Ambitions: Superintelligence and Talent Acquisition

This acquisition is part of Meta’s larger, aggressive push into artificial intelligence:

  • Superintelligence Labs: Meta has consolidated its AI research under the new Meta Superintelligence Labs, led by Alexandr Wang, former CEO of Scale AI. This division is tasked with developing next-generation AI models that can reason, remember, and communicate at or beyond the human level.
  • Talent Recruitment: Meta has been on a hiring spree, attracting top AI researchers from OpenAI, Google DeepMind, and Anthropic, often with lucrative offers.
  • Massive Investment: The company has earmarked up to $65 billion for AI infrastructure in 2025, signaling its intent to lead the global AI race.

Financial Terms Remain Confidential

While the acquisition has been confirmed, the financial details remain undisclosed. Bloomberg previously reported that Meta and Play AI were in talks regarding the deal, but neither company has released further specifics.
